Question 891846: A chemist has three solutions containing a given acid. First solution contains 10% of the acid solution; second solution has 30%, and the third one has 50%. He/she desires to use the three solutions to obtain a mixture of 50 L containing 32% of acid by using twice the 50% solution than 30% solution. How many liters from each solution are to be used?
